Mixed Rice Salad with Tuna contains 449 calories per serving (22% of a 2,000 kcal daily diet), with 14g fat, 58g carbs, and 21g protein. This nutrition data is based on real meals tracked by Arise app users.
| Ingredient | Amount | kcal | Fat | Carb | Protein |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Cooked Rice | 180 g | 234 | 1.8 | 48.6 | 4.5 |
| Tuna (canned in water, drained) | 60 g | 65 | 0.6 | 0 | 14.4 |
| Tomato | 50 g | 9 | 0.1 | 2 | 0.5 |
| Red Onion | 30 g | 12 | 0.1 | 2.8 | 0.3 |
| Lettuce | 20 g | 3 | 0.1 | 0.6 | 0.2 |
| Chickpeas | 20 g | 26 | 0.5 | 4 | 1.4 |
| Dressing (oil-based) | 15 ml | 100 | 11.1 | 0 | 0 |
Macronutrients (Fat, Carbs, Protein) are shown in grams (g).
